Overview of US30 on TradingView

The US30 index, representing 30 major companies, is a popular choice for traders seeking exposure to the US stock market. TradingView offers comprehensive tools to analyze and monitor the US30, allowing traders to make informed decisions.

Setting Up Your TradingView Workspace

Customize your TradingView workspace to focus on the US30. Utilize multiple chart layouts, add relevant indicators, and set up alerts to stay updated with market movements.

Key Indicators for US30 Trading

Use technical indicators such as Moving Averages, Relative Strength Index (RSI), and MACD to identify trends and potential entry or exit points for US30 trades.

Chart Patterns and Analysis

Identify and interpret chart patterns like head and shoulders, double tops, and support and resistance levels to enhance your trading strategy on the US30.

Developing a Trading Strategy

Create a robust trading strategy by combining technical analysis, risk management techniques, and backtesting your approach using TradingView's historical data features.

Risk Management Tips

Implement effective risk management practices such as setting stop-loss orders and managing position sizes to protect your capital while trading the US30.
